Unit 4: Energy Forms & Transformations
Help!
|
|
||||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| chemical energy | the energy stored in chemical bonds
🗑
|
||||
| electrical energy | the energy of moving electrons
🗑
|
||||
| energy | the ability to do work; measured in Joules
🗑
|
||||
| Law of Conservation of Energy | states that energy can not be created or destroyed, only transferred
🗑
|
||||
| mechanical energy | sum of the potential and kinetic energy of a system; energy of motion
🗑
|
||||
| nuclear energy | energy associated with changes in the nucleus of an atom
🗑
|
||||
| radiant energy | energy carried by an electromagnetic wave
🗑
|
||||
| thermal energy | sum of the kinetic and potential energy of the particles in an object
🗑
|
||||
| energy transformation | the change of one form of energy to another
